Enchanting Weekend Trips from London by Train
Railway journeys remain among the most scenic and stress-free options for weekend trips away from London. The British rail network showcases countryside vistas that simply cannot be experienced from motorways, transforming your journey into part of the adventure itself. Bath stands as a perennial favorite, just ninety minutes away, where Roman history meets Georgian architecture in stunning harmony. The honey-colored stone buildings, thermal springs, and Jane Austen connections create an atmosphere of timeless elegance.
Cambridge offers another magnificent train journey, placing you among prestigious university colleges and charming riverside walks within an hour. Punting along the River Cam, exploring ancient libraries, and wandering through botanical gardens provide a scholarly yet relaxing atmosphere. Oxford presents similar academic grandeur with its dreaming spires and literary heritage, accessible via direct services from Paddington or Marylebone stations.
The Lake District, though requiring a longer journey of approximately three hours, rewards travelers with England’s most spectacular natural landscapes. Windermere’s shimmering waters, dramatic fells, and picturesque villages inspired Wordsworth and Beatrix Potter, and continue enchanting modern visitors. Booking advance tickets often reveals surprisingly affordable fares, making these destinations accessible on various budgets.
Brighton remains the quintessential seaside escape, combining bohemian culture with traditional British beach resort charm. The journey takes just under an hour, depositing you near the famous pier, Royal Pavilion, and endless independent shops tucked into the historic Lanes. The pebble beaches might surprise those expecting sand, but the vibrant atmosphere and fresh seafood more than compensate.
Spectacular Weekend Trips from London to Europe
European destinations provide incredible variety for those seeking international adventures. Weekend trips from London to Europe have become remarkably straightforward thanks to budget airlines and the Eurostar high-speed rail service. Paris epitomizes romantic weekend breaks, sitting just over two hours away via Eurostar. Emerging directly in the city center allows immediate immersion into Parisian life, from croissants at corner cafés to evening strolls along the Seine beneath twinkling lights.
Amsterdam offers a completely different flavor, where canal-side architecture meets world-class museums and cycling culture. The flight duration barely exceeds an hour, while the city’s compact size ensures you can experience highlights without feeling rushed. Exploring the Anne Frank House, admiring Van Gogh’s masterpieces, and sampling Dutch delicacies at local markets creates a rich cultural tapestry.
Brussels serves as Europe’s capital and a gastronomic paradise where Belgian chocolate, waffles, and beer reach perfection. The Grand Place’s ornate guild houses create one of Europe’s most photographed squares, while the city’s quirky humor manifests in attractions like the Manneken Pis statue. Eurostar connections make Brussels incredibly convenient, with journey times under two hours.
Dublin’s literary heritage and friendly pub culture beckon travelers seeking Celtic charm combined with vibrant nightlife. Short flights connect London with Ireland’s capital, where Georgian architecture frames lively Temple Bar streets. Guinness tours, Trinity College’s Long Room library, and coastal walks in nearby Howth provide diverse experiences within one compact weekend.
Edinburgh’s dramatic skyline, dominated by its imposing castle perched on volcanic rock, creates an unforgettable backdrop for weekend exploration. The Scottish capital blends medieval Old Town cobblestones with elegant New Town crescents, while nearby Arthur’s Seat offers hiking with panoramic views. Summer festivals transform the city into a cultural powerhouse, though Edinburgh captivates year-round.

Frequently Asked Questions About Weekend Trips from London
What are the cheapest weekend destinations from London?
Brighton, Cambridge, and Oxford offer affordable train fares and reasonable accommodation rates. European options like Brussels and Amsterdam frequently feature budget airline deals under fifty pounds return when booked in advance.
How far in advance should I book weekend trips from London?
Booking six to eight weeks ahead typically balances availability with promotional pricing. Last-minute weekend breaks sometimes offer bargains, but risk limited choices during popular periods.
Can I visit Europe for a weekend without flying?
Absolutely. Eurostar connects London with Paris, Brussels, Amsterdam, and numerous other European cities via high-speed rail, offering comfortable, environmentally friendly travel without airport hassles.
What’s the best time for weekend getaways from London?
Spring and autumn provide pleasant weather with fewer crowds, while summer offers the longest daylight hours for sightseeing. Winter city breaks embrace festive markets and cozy atmospheres at lower prices.
Are weekend trips from London by train better than driving?
Trains eliminate parking concerns, allow relaxation during travel, and often reach city centers faster than driving, especially for destinations like Bath, York, and Edinburgh. However, rural areas with limited public transport favor car travel.
